Your iP is: 3.15.1.201 United States Near: Columbus, Ohio, United States

IP Lookup Details:

IP Information - 49.79.64.220

Host name: 49.79.64.220

Country: China

Country Code: CN

Region: 04

City: Nanjing

Latitude: 32.0617

Longitude: 118.7778

Whois information
Oliverjzi

It attempted to use the FTP server to distribute phishing emails.

Reported on: 9th, Jan. 2025
Complaint Form